HALE COUNTY, TX — A fatal crash in Hale County early Tuesday morning resulted in the death of a 70-year-old man from Silverton, Texas.
The Texas Department of Public Safety reported that Eloy Reyna, 70, was killed in a single-vehicle crash at approximately 7:20 a.m. on March 4 on FM 400 near County Road Z.
According to DPS, Reyna was driving a 2007 Chevrolet Impala northbound on FM 400 when he came to a sharp curve in the road. The vehicle left the roadway and traveled into the east ditch, where it rolled over and came to rest upright.
Reyna was not wearing a seatbelt and suffered fatal injuries in the crash. He was pronounced dead at the scene by responding authorities.
Weather conditions at the time of the crash included rain and high winds, and the road was wet.
The posted speed limit on FM 400 is 75 mph. DPS has not yet confirmed whether weather, speed, or other factors contributed to the crash.
The Texas Department of Public Safety is still investigating the crash, and more information will be released as details become available.
